指定导出的csv文件的分隔符,默认为逗号分隔符。 ● encoding: str。指定导出的csv文件的编码,默认为utf-8 2.2 excel文件 2.2.1 导入excel文件 常用参数解析: read_excel和read_csv的用法差不多,一个需要注意的参数是sheet_name。这个参数是指定读取该excel中具体哪个表的数据,默认为0,即为第一个表。如果传入1,...
DataFrame.to_csv(path_or_buf=None,sep=',',na_rep='',float_format=None,columns=None,header=True,index=True,index_label=None,mode='w',encoding=None,compression='infer',quoting=None,quotechar='"',line_terminator=None,chunksize=None,date_format=None,doublequote=True,escapechar=None,decimal='....
sep=';',encoding='latin-1',nrows=1000, kiprows=[2,5])
json_normalize level ...将嵌套的“行程”列降级为长字符串
pandas.read_sql():用于读取数据库,传入sql语句,需要配合其他库连接数据库。 由于我本地没有数据库资源,我这边就已csv文件为例: import pandas as pd data = pd.read_csv('directory.csv', encoding='utf-8') # data.head()默认显示前5条记录,类似还有data.tail() ...
with engine.connect() as conn, conn.begin(): data = pd.read_sql_table("data", conn) 警告 当你打开与数据库的连接时,你也有责任关闭它。保持连接打开的副作用可能包括锁定数据库或其他破坏性行为。 写入数据框 假设以下数据存储在一个DataFrame data中,我们可以使用to_sql()将其插入到数据库中。 id...
将CSV直接转换为数据框。有时CSV载入数据还需要指定一种编码(即:encoding='ISO-8859–1')。如果数据框包含不可读的字符,应首先尝试上述方法。。对于表格文件,存在一个叫做pd.read_excel的类似函数。anime =pd.read_csv('anime-recommendations-database/anime.csv')根据输入数据构建数据框 这在手动示例化简单...
data = pd.read_html("http://www.air-level.com/rank", encoding='utf-8', header=0)[1]# 即可获取右边表格 3.批量 以新浪财经机构持股汇总数据为例: # 网址:http://vip.stock.finance.sina.com.cn/q/go.php/vComStockHold/kind/jgcg/index.phtml?p=46# 共47页importpandasaspd ...
导出到CSV:to_csv # 导出到csv df2.to_csv(path_or_buf="sql_table.csv", columns=['id', 'name']) 1. 2. 函数参数: path_or_buf: 字符串、路径对象、file-like对象、None,默认值None。 字符串、路径对象,或实现了write()函数的file-like对象,如果为None,则结果以字符串形式返回。
DataFrame.to_excel(excel_writer=None, sheetname=None, na_rep=’’,header=True, index=True, index_label=None, mode='w’, encoding=None) to_csv方法的常用参数基本一致,区别之处在于指定存储文件的文件路径参数名称为excel_writer,并且没有sep参数,增加了一个sheetnames参数用来指定存储的Excel sheet的名称...